Best Hogwarts Legacy Rog Ally Settings for high FPS & performance

Best Hogwarts Legacy Rog Ally Settings for high FPS & performance

Without any further ado, to access these settings, start from the main menu or the paused menu, then head to the Settings section. Scroll down until you find the Display Options menu. Once you’ve adjusted the options here, move to the next tab labelled Graphics Options, where you’ll find further graphical settings to tweak. Here are all the settings you can tweak:

Display Options

  • Window Mode: Windowed Fullscreen
  • Upscale Type: AMD FSR 2
  • Upscale Mode: Balanced
  • Upscale Sharpness: 1.0
  • VSync: Off
  • Framerate: 120 FPS
  • Motion Blur: Off
  • Depth Of Field: Off
  • Chromatic Aberration: Off
  • Film Grain: Off

Graphics Options

  • Effects Quality: Medium
  • Material Quality: Medium
  • Fog Quality: Medium
  • Sky Quality: Medium
  • Foliage Quality: Low
  • Post Process Quality: Low
  • Shadow Quality: Medium
  • Texture Quality: Medium
  • View Distance Quality: Low
  • Population Quality: Low

Tips and Advice

Hogwarts Legacy runs well on the ASUS ROG Ally, giving you some wiggle room to tweak the settings further.  The settings we’ve provided here serve as a great starting point. If you feel like you can compromise on the visuals and/or performance even more for the other, don’t hesitate to experiment with the settings to find what works best for you. As a tip, we recommend keeping your device plugged in or docked while gaming, ensuring it has the necessary power to maximize its hardware potential. Additionally, regardless of the charging state of your device, it’s wise to run games in the performance mode of the Rog Ally.
